Police arrest one of 10 most wanted in Ormoc

ORMOC CITY, Philippines  – A little over three years in hiding, a man charged with frustrated murder finally fell into the hands of the police.

Romeo Ollave, now 52 years old, single and a resident of Barangay Magaswe but temporarily residing in the mountain Barangay Cabingtan was surprised when operatives swooped into the neighborhood and his house where he was arrested.

Senior Insp. Shevert Alvin Machete, chief of the city’s Police Station 1, told The Freeman that Ollave went into hiding after he hacked with a bolo a certain Elizer Lamoste in 2008.

The victim suffered right eye damage as a result and was confined in a hospital. 

On January 2010, a warrant of arrest against Ollave, under Criminal Case R-ORM-09-00038-CR for frustrated murder, was issued by Judge Apolinario Buaya of RTC Branch 35 based in Ormoc City.

Ollave, listed by the police one of the ten most wanted people in the city, is now detained at the Police station 1 cell.

The court recommended a bail of P200,000 for his temporary liberty. —(FREEMAN)
